位置: 编程技术 - 正文

Javascript 普通函数和构造函数的区别(javascript中的函数该如何理解)

编辑:rootadmin

推荐整理分享Javascript 普通函数和构造函数的区别(javascript中的函数该如何理解),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:javascript function函数,javascript函数,javascript中函数,javascript函数,javascript常用函数大全,javascript常用函数大全,javascript常用函数大全,javascript常用函数大全,内容如对您有帮助,希望把文章链接给更多的朋友!

普通函数和构造函数的区别

在命名规则上,构造函数一般是首字母大写,普通函数遵照小驼峰式命名法。

在函数调用的时候:

function fn() { }

构造函数:1. new fn( ) 2 .构造函数内部会创建一个新的对象,即f的实例 3. 函数内部的this指向 新创建的f的实例 4. 默认的返回值是f的实例

Javascript 普通函数和构造函数的区别(javascript中的函数该如何理解)

普通函数:1. fn( ) 2. 在调用函数的内部不会创建新的对象 3. 函数内部的this指向调用函数的对象(如果没有对象调用,默认是window) 4. 返回值由return语句决定

构造函数的返回值:

有一个默认的返回值,新创建的对象(实例); 当手动添加返回值后(return语句):

1. 返回值是基本数据类型-->真正的返回值还是那个新创建的对象(实例) 2. 返回值是复杂数据类型(对象)-->真正的返回值是这个对象

看一个常见的面试题

感谢阅读,希望能帮助到大家,谢谢大家对本站的支持!

JS 全屏和退出全屏详解及实例代码 JS全屏和退出全屏js实现浏览器窗口全屏和退出全屏的功能,市面上主流浏览器如:谷歌、火狐、等都是兼容的,不过IE低版本有点瑕疵(全屏状态下

Javascript数组循环遍历之forEach详解 1.js数组循环遍历。数组循环变量,最先想到的就是for(vari=0;icount;i++)这样的方式了。除此之外,也可以使用较简便的forEach方式2.forEach函数。Firefox和Chrome

Ajax的概述与实现过程 一、ajax概述1、Ajax是Asynchronous(['skrns)JavaScriptXML的简写,不是一门新技术,而是对现有技术的综合利用。这一技术能够向服务器请求额外数据而无需刷

标签: javascript中的函数该如何理解

本文链接地址:https://www.jiuchutong.com/biancheng/376020.html 转载请保留说明!

上一篇:详解js运算符单竖杠“|”与“||”的用法和作用介绍(js的运算符)

下一篇:JS 全屏和退出全屏详解及实例代码(js 浏览器全屏)

  • 自来水安装增值税税率
  • 定期定额自行申报流程
  • 业务招待费如何进行纳税筹划
  • 外购无形资产的摊销额计入什么费用
  • 办公费专票怎么做账
  • 个人向公司账户存款
  • 红字专用发票能作废吗
  • 初级会计考试税率要记吗
  • 企业存货占用资金的比例
  • 出售闲置的材料物资
  • 发票过期了还能抵扣吗
  • 当年应收账款无明细科目
  • 企业清算时未抵扣的进项税账务处理
  • 进项税额不可抵扣
  • 工伤期间奖金发放标准
  • 所得税季报固定资产加速折旧表资产原值
  • 销项负数盖章吗
  • 农产品收购发票怎么抵扣
  • 发票勾选平台显示不成功
  • 税收筹划也要有风险意识
  • 未分配利润为负的原因
  • 银行承兑汇票怎么取钱
  • 支付知识产权服务费账务处理
  • 利润分配补亏
  • 积分抵现金活动怎么做
  • 在电脑上呢
  • 简单了解php编程软件
  • 跨年的定额发票可以用吗
  • 收到税务汇算清缴怎么办
  • 网线插上还是显示红叉
  • 高德地图海量点图层刷新
  • 申请高新技术企业的好处
  • php有面向对象吗
  • 房地产企业项目开发法律风险
  • vue实现返回顶部
  • php分层
  • ubuntu busier
  • lvm 命令
  • php对象是值传递还是引用传递
  • 小规模纳税人进口增值税怎么处理
  • docker管理系统
  • 增值税政策执行口径存在的问题及建议
  • 快递怎么做账单
  • 个人所得税汇算清缴怎么计算
  • 房屋租赁房产税如何征收
  • 预充值发票可以报销吗
  • 差旅费报销会计分录题目
  • 仓库转租合同
  • 投标代理费如何入账
  • 投资软件和信息技术服务业
  • 去年多摊销了怎么办
  • 记账凭证是不是转账凭证
  • 小规模纳税人销售使用过的固定资产
  • 电费发票未到怎么入账
  • 科目汇总表里的应交税费
  • 建造固定资产的账务处理(出包方式)
  • 如何监测和优化电池寿命
  • mysql错误处理
  • sqlserver数据库显示单个用户
  • windowsxp错误提示
  • 双击盘符弹出属性
  • ubuntu :wq
  • ubuntu 安装zsh
  • net 4.0.30319
  • 32位与64位操作系统怎么区分从32位和64位的概念上进行讲述
  • windows7开机
  • win10预览版21337
  • xp系统怎么打开启动项
  • 命令行sudo无效
  • win10 directx9
  • perl怎么读取文件
  • 手游频繁崩溃怎么解决
  • three.js入门教程(合集)
  • androidui框架
  • jq设置下拉框的值
  • Python的SQLalchemy模块连接与操作MySQL的基础示例
  • 贵州省地方税务局房地产税收征收管理办法
  • 乌市社保缴费一个月多少钱
  • 广西12366社保缴费APP
  • 煤炭资源税税率表
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设